Bone morphogenetic protein 4 (BMP4) is a proinflammatory factor. The expression of BMP4 is reduced in the adipose and enhanced in the myocardium and vascular during obesity. It is possibly involved in the process of inflammatory response of the myocardium and vascular. Obesity, often regarded as a risk factor for cardiovascular diseases, is a kind of inflammatory response. This study aimed to investigate the relationship of BMP4 with obesity and cardiovascular disease. Ob/ob mice were used as the experimental group, and C57BL/6 mice were used as the control group. The two groups were further divided into 2 subgroups based on the mice carrying adenovirus-encoding shRNA for BMP4 or Lac Z genes. The messenger RNA and protein levels of BMP4, interleukin-1β, and interleukin-9 were significantly higher in the myocardial tissue and aorta of ob/ob+ Lac Z shRNA than those in the other 3 groups, whereas the levels in the ob/ob+ BMP4 shRNA group were significantly decreased and comparable with those in the control groups. BMP4 is significantly upregulated in the myocardial tissue and aorta of obese mice, and this suggests that BMP4 is an risk factor involved in the local inflammatory response.
